Westgarth is a neighbourhood within the suburb of Northcote, about 4 or 5 km north-east of Melbourne's central business district in Victoria, Australia. It is in the local government area of the City of Darebin. The neighbourhood has a commercial centre, distinct from the main commercial centre of Northcote, located near Westgarth railway station, just north of Clifton Hill. While Westgarth does not have any official borders, it is generally considered to extend from Merri Creek in the west to the boundary of Fairfield in the east.
